    Cheapest place to buy St Croix

    Just like the title says looking to purchase a few new St. Croix rods, who has the best deals on these rods? I searched around and didn’t find much. Thanks for any help

    So, the cheapest place would be the St. Croix factory store. That being said, if you want “new” but don’t care that the rods have a 1 year warranty, you can order factory seconds for half off. I bought a brand new legend tournament this year for $130. You can order from the factory store.

    Wait for the Black Friday sale at Tackle Warehouse. I bought 2 Legend Tournaments last year with a 20% TW discount plus a coupon for another $5.00 plus free shipping. As low a price as I’ve found, amd ive got 12 SC rods. Tackle Direct used to offer points for providing online reviews. I racked up enough points over a couple of years to get some deep discounts on several. Haven’t looked that program in a while. Might check it out. They carry a big selection of SC rods.

    You can buy factory seconds, called B stock rods, one year warranty for half off. I know for a fact you can now order those over the phone. The guy you talked to must have been short on coffee that day.
